Diabetes drug maker Amylin Pharmaceuticals Inc. (AMLN) drew four first-round bids valuing the company at $25 to $29 a share, with Pfizer Inc. (PFE) dropping out of the process, Bloomberg News reported Monday on its website, citing people with knowledge of the process.

AstraZeneca Plc (AZN), Sanofi (SNY), Merck & Co. (MRK) and Bristol-Myers Squibb Co. (BMY) submitted offers, with revised offers due by the end of the month and a sale likely in July, two people told Bloomberg.

Representatives for Amylin, Merck, Bristol-Myers, AstraZeneca, Sanofi and Pfizer declined comment to Bloomberg.
